UK Trade With EU

Question for Department for International Trade

UIN 133617, tabled on 21 March 2018

To ask the Secretary of State for International Trade, pursuant to the Answer of 31 January 2018 to Question 125208 on UK trade with the EU, whether any third countries have made any proposals for commitments that could result in a material difference from those in the agreement that is being replicated.

Answered on

28 March 2018

Our partners understand that providing continuity in our existing trading arrangements is a technical exercise and that we are currently limited in what we can negotiate due to our continuing EU membership, and that timescales make renegotiation difficult.

Partners, as the UK, wish to ensure that their businesses and consumers don't lose market access as a result of the UK leaving the EU.
